Freekeh Soup For Two

Freekeh Soup For Two

Freekeh is an ancient grain that is packed with nutrients and has a slightly nutty flavor. This will serve 2 as a main or 4 as a appetizer.

Preparation Time
15 mins
Cooking Time
25 mins
Total Time
40 mins
Calories
311 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Heat oil in a saucepan over medium heat. Add onion and cook until slightly softened, about 3 minutes. Add garlic and cook until fragrant, about 30 seconds. Stir in freekeh and toast for 3 minutes. Add carrot, celery leaves, parsley, salt, pepper, and bay leaf.
Step 2
B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er until freekeh is tender, 15 to 20 minutes. Taste and adjust seasoning.
Step 3
Allow soup to rest for 5 minutes. Remove bay leaf and serve.
Freekeh Soup For Two

Ingredients

  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 ½ tablespoons olive oil
  • ½ teaspoon dried parsley
  • 1 large bay leaf
  • ½ cup coarsely chopped onion
  • 1 clove garlic, smashed and chopped
  • ½ cup freekeh [frikeh, fireek, farik]
  • 1 medium carrot, peeled and roughly chopped
  • 3 tablespoons celery leaves, chopped
  • 3 cups Chicken Stock-Dry-Prepared EFC
